Transaction 52514b91fc770fed1b2e91d5048dbf6d28a4b9cc6a677d309d355bfa992b15c4

1 Input
2 Outputs
  • 52514b91fc770fed1b2e91d5048dbf6d28a4b9cc6a677d309d355bfa992b15c4:0
  • value  17548214
    address  3Df6LFYrajToLLnbVaGghMZXZMNCygjvL6
  • 52514b91fc770fed1b2e91d5048dbf6d28a4b9cc6a677d309d355bfa992b15c4:1
  • value  12819853
    address  bc1qyza5yxp59ejg520vqrt8cj3k7pev7xxp8n72cx